The National SX-D26P clutch release bearing is a critical component for the 1947-1950 GMC FC250 transmission. This part is responsible for transmitting the force from the clutch pedal to the clutch release fork, allowing the clutch to disengage. Here are some pros and cons of buying this clutch release bearing:
Pros:1. High-quality bearing: The National SX-D26P clutch release bearing is manufactured using high-quality materials to ensure durability and reliability.
2. OEM-style design: This bearing is designed to be an exact fit for the 1947-1950 GMC FC250 transmission, making it a direct replacement for the original part.
3. Reduces clutch pedal effort: A worn-out clutch release bearing can make it difficult to press the clutch pedal all the way to the floor. Replacing the bearing can make the pedal easier to press, improving driver comfort and safety.
4. Prevents clutch slippage: A faulty clutch release bearing can cause the clutch to slip, resulting in power loss and reduced performance. Replacing the bearing can help prevent this issue.
5. Improves transmission shift quality: A worn-out clutch release bearing can cause rough shifts or difficulty engaging gears. A new bearing can improve the transmission shift quality, making for smoother and more consistent shifts.
Cons:1. Cost: The National SX-D26P clutch release bearing can be more expensive than some aftermarket alternatives. However, the cost may be worth it for the improved quality and reliability.
2. Installation difficulty: Installing the clutch release bearing can be a challenging task, especially for those without experience working on manual transmissions. It may be necessary to remove the transmission to access the bearing, making it a time-consuming process.
3. Potential for other clutch components to need replacement: A worn-out clutch release bearing may be a sign of other clutch components that need replacement, such as the clutch disc or pressure plate. Replacing just the bearing may not be a permanent solution, and additional clutch components may need to be replaced in the future.
